We are not saved by works, but we are saved by grace, our works come through Faith and
as we walk in our daily relationship with God He speaks to us.
God speaks to everyone all the time, He speaks to those who do not recognise His voice
and He speaks to those who are saved and being saved, He spoke to those saved long
before they were saved.
And to each person who is saved is given a measure of Faith and Faith comes through
hearing and hearing through Christ - Romans 10:17
To each is given a measure of faith and Jesus uses the example of the mustard seed here,
He could have used any example, He could have used the example of a grain of sand becoming
as numerous as the stars in the sky, He could have used the illustration of A basket with
loaves and fish, He could have used the parable of a coin being used to multiply and to grow.

But He used the picture of a tiny mustard seed and as we act upon what we believe God is
saying to us, so we exercise our faith, we put our faith into action and we see the measure
of faith grow and this does not end there, but each time we put the words we hear into action and apply
the word to our lifes and hearts we see the measure grow, we see the mustard seed growing
into a plant and getting bigger and bigger and bigger.
Do not merely listen to the word,
and so deceive yourselves. Do what it says - James 1:22.
